    A lot of 14.1" offer an upgrade to WXGA+ (1440x900), but that's the highest resolution currently available in that size. Very few 13.3" offer any higher resolution options beyond the standard 1280x800. The exception is the Lenovo ThinkPad X300 and X301, both of which are 13.3" with a standard 1440x900 LED-backlit display....and a starting price tag of more than $1800!

    Off the cuff, the following 14.1" are available with the 1440x900 display-

    Toshiba Tecra M10
    ASUS F8
    Lenovo ThinkPad T400 (CCFL or LED)
    Lenovo ThinkPad R400
    Lenovo ThinkPad SL400
    Dell Latitude E5400
    Dell Latitude E6400 (LED)
    Dell Precision M2400 (LED)
    Dell Inspiron 1420
    HP Compaq 6510b
    HP Compaq 6530b
    HP Compaq 6535b
    HP Compaq 6910p
    HP EliteBook 6930p
